Traffic is now flowing on Ohio State Route 7 Southbound, just north of Brilliant.
Earlier today, a blast caused the rock wall barrier to be moved into the southbound lanes.
ODOT Spokesperson Becky Giaugue tells 7News that the mess was cleared up and traffic began moving around 2:30 this afternoon.
Crews will review video footage of the blast to see what went wrong.
The work is all part of a $30 million project to excavate approximately 2.8 million cubic yards of unstable material.
